Transaction ec797d508d2aa0325f93b72df8c9923ced253ac5bb1c67aa41e3ce33d44c88f4
1 Input
1 Output
-
ec797d508d2aa0325f93b72df8c9923ced253ac5bb1c67aa41e3ce33d44c88f4:0
- value
- 1353956
- script pubkey
- OP_0 OP_PUSHBYTES_20 efe6317c8dd919b101d8dd0905d3d97c61066aec
- address
- bc1qalnrzlydmyvmzqwcm5yst57e03ssv6hvqk234c